DEV Community

Accessibility

the practice of making your website usable by as many people as possible

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
A11Y 101: Hiding content

A11Y 101: Hiding content

Reactions 7 Comments
1 min read
How to NOT use aria-label

How to NOT use aria-label

Reactions 9 Comments 2
4 min read
An Introduction to Web Accessibility and the Value of Semantics

An Introduction to Web Accessibility and the Value of Semantics

Reactions 2 Comments
7 min read
A11Y 101: Missing form labels

A11Y 101: Missing form labels

Reactions 9 Comments 2
2 min read
A11Y 101: Ensure landmarks are unique

A11Y 101: Ensure landmarks are unique

Reactions 16 Comments
2 min read
Zephyr, Web Bluetooth and Accessibility

Zephyr, Web Bluetooth and Accessibility

Reactions 9 Comments
4 min read
Improve the accessibility of your website

Improve the accessibility of your website

Reactions 15 Comments 5
2 min read
What's the Alternative (Text)?

What's the Alternative (Text)?

Reactions 11 Comments 1
2 min read
A11Y 101: Accessible cards with multiple links

A11Y 101: Accessible cards with multiple links

Reactions 13 Comments 2
3 min read
A11Y 101: Semantic HTML always wins

A11Y 101: Semantic HTML always wins

Reactions 18 Comments
2 min read
Web Development === Accessibility

Web Development === Accessibility

Reactions 246 Comments 25
7 min read
A11Y 101: Analysing my website issues

A11Y 101: Analysing my website issues

Reactions 19 Comments 2
3 min read
A11Y 101: Evaluating my website

A11Y 101: Evaluating my website

Reactions 23 Comments 2
2 min read
Happy Global Accessibility Awareness Day!

Happy Global Accessibility Awareness Day!

Reactions 87 Comments 13
2 min read
Accessibility 101

Accessibility 101

Reactions 10 Comments
4 min read
How We All Benefit from Accessibility

How We All Benefit from Accessibility

Reactions 15 Comments 1
3 min read
A11Y 101: Evaluation tools

A11Y 101: Evaluation tools

Reactions 16 Comments 2
4 min read
What Cypress E2E testing has taught us about our code

What Cypress E2E testing has taught us about our code

Reactions 70 Comments 7
5 min read
Accessibility (A11y) why is it so important?🧵

Accessibility (A11y) why is it so important?🧵

Reactions 39 Comments 3
2 min read
A11Y 101: How to use a screenreader

A11Y 101: How to use a screenreader

Reactions 14 Comments
3 min read
5 Places to get started with Web Accessibility

5 Places to get started with Web Accessibility

Reactions 8 Comments 1
2 min read
Making your :focus style fit in with one line of CSS

Making your :focus style fit in with one line of CSS

Reactions 7 Comments
1 min read
A11Y 101: What's WCAG

A11Y 101: What's WCAG

Reactions 16 Comments
3 min read
A11Y 101: Type of users and how they interact

A11Y 101: Type of users and how they interact

Reactions 19 Comments 5
5 min read
May contributing.today: on technical documentation, docs tools and markup languages 📖

May contributing.today: on technical documentation, docs tools and markup languages 📖

Reactions 6 Comments
5 min read
A11Y 101: What is accessibility

A11Y 101: What is accessibility

Reactions 39 Comments 4
3 min read
Fixing the accessibility of Inspection overlays

Fixing the accessibility of Inspection overlays

Reactions 6 Comments
2 min read
How I want to get from a11y minded to a11y expert

How I want to get from a11y minded to a11y expert

Reactions 38 Comments 16
2 min read
Keyboard Testing: The A11y Enhancement to Your Definition of Done

Keyboard Testing: The A11y Enhancement to Your Definition of Done

Reactions 10 Comments
3 min read
Build Accessible React Toggle Buttons

Build Accessible React Toggle Buttons

Reactions 7 Comments 2
14 min read
The 5 Short Frontend tips for May

The 5 Short Frontend tips for May

Reactions 7 Comments 2
4 min read
Svelte - a shortcut to a11y?

Svelte - a shortcut to a11y?

Reactions 13 Comments
6 min read
(Not) giving up one’s Agency: some personal notes about beyond tellerrand conference 2022 in Düsseldorf

(Not) giving up one’s Agency: some personal notes about beyond tellerrand conference 2022 in Düsseldorf

Reactions 16 Comments 4
7 min read
Utilizing Native Dialog in Elm

Utilizing Native Dialog in Elm

Reactions 7 Comments
6 min read
What's Your Heading?

What's Your Heading?

Reactions 17 Comments 1
4 min read
Project Prism: architecture overview

Project Prism: architecture overview

Reactions 9 Comments
3 min read
55 sec about a11y - users (part 2)

55 sec about a11y - users (part 2)

Reactions 3 Comments
3 min read
👋 Introducing ourselves [plus we want YOUR opinion on our logo...😍 or 🤮]

👋 Introducing ourselves [plus we want YOUR opinion on our logo...😍 or 🤮]

Reactions 15 Comments 30
2 min read
The 4 Short Frontend tips for April

The 4 Short Frontend tips for April

Reactions 8 Comments
4 min read
Building a non-blocking page loader

Building a non-blocking page loader

Reactions 7 Comments
1 min read
Stop Removing Focus

Stop Removing Focus

Reactions 90 Comments 22
2 min read
Routing: I’m not smart enough for a SPA

Routing: I’m not smart enough for a SPA

Reactions 199 Comments 20
14 min read
How to use Chrome DevTools to find a color fixing insufficient color contrast ratio on your HTML element

How to use Chrome DevTools to find a color fixing insufficient color contrast ratio on your HTML element

Reactions 3 Comments
2 min read
Apps for Everyone in Flutter

Apps for Everyone in Flutter

Reactions 6 Comments
3 min read
You've been sent here because you've designed a site which has text over the top of an image

You've been sent here because you've designed a site which has text over the top of an image

Reactions 6 Comments
3 min read
Web Accessibility

Web Accessibility

Reactions 8 Comments
3 min read
La espera terminó: el elemento DIALOG alcanza pleno soporte

La espera terminó: el elemento DIALOG alcanza pleno soporte

Reactions 5 Comments
5 min read
Intro to Website Accessibility with CSS

Intro to Website Accessibility with CSS

Reactions 6 Comments
2 min read
Assistive technologies your users might be using

Assistive technologies your users might be using

Reactions 6 Comments
2 min read
Accessible Toggle

Accessible Toggle

Reactions 126 Comments 12
2 min read
Web Scraping: Use ARIA attributes to crawl accessible components

Web Scraping: Use ARIA attributes to crawl accessible components

Reactions 6 Comments
10 min read
Build An Accessible React Carousel

Build An Accessible React Carousel

Reactions 8 Comments 2
9 min read
Deepgram x Twitch Hackathon Submission

Deepgram x Twitch Hackathon Submission

Reactions 12 Comments 1
4 min read
Project Prism: on the road to building an open smartphone

Project Prism: on the road to building an open smartphone

Reactions 60 Comments 16
4 min read
Autism and UI/UX

Autism and UI/UX

Reactions 10 Comments 1
1 min read
SvelteKit Accessibility Testing: Automated CI A11y Tests

SvelteKit Accessibility Testing: Automated CI A11y Tests

Reactions 7 Comments 1
9 min read
You don't need... JavaScript to do tabs

You don't need... JavaScript to do tabs

Reactions 15 Comments 4
2 min read
The devil is in the details…

The devil is in the details…

Reactions 18 Comments 4
2 min read
Add a "skip to main content" navigation link to your website to improve accessibility

Add a "skip to main content" navigation link to your website to improve accessibility

Reactions 4 Comments 4
4 min read
Enabling keyboard navigation on your Mac

Enabling keyboard navigation on your Mac

Reactions 28 Comments 6
1 min read
loading...